You can consider to make a big raise pre-flop, but I wouldn’t be surprise you will still end multiway and playing a big pot out of position isn’t to great ether and checking is most likely the best here.

As played I wouldn’t mind to bet for thin value and protection on flop and turn. If 1 is raising you have an easy fold I think.

Depends on the card and the donkey's besitze... When the flushdraw gets there, be it on the turn or on the River, I would certainly slow down and fold to any bigger bet...
